A magnificent neobaroque theatre inspired by the Paris Opera, the Arriaga Theatre is a true architectural gem of Bilbao. Inaugurated in 1890, it stands out with its grand façade and ornate interior, making it one of the city's most iconic landmarks.

San Nikolas eliza
The Church of San Nicolás de Bari, designed by Ignacio Ibero, is located in a prime area of Bilbao, close to Areatza Park and the Arriaga Theatre. Built between 1743 and 1756, this historical church is a symbol of Bilbao’s early development along the Nervión River.

BBVA
The impressive BBVA building, formerly the Banco de Bilbao, was designed by French architect Eugène Lavalle in the mid-19th century. With its Beaux-Arts style, this grand structure on Plaza de San Nicolás is a testament to the city’s evolving financial history.

Biblioteca Central de Bidebarrieta
Bidebarrieta Library, named after the "new road" built in 1483, is a beautiful cultural hub located in a historic building. It offers visitors a quiet space to explore literature and engage in cultural events, reflecting Bilbao's rich heritage.

Plaza Nueva
Situated in Bilbao’s Old Town, Plaza Nueva is a stunning Neoclassical square with 18 arches on two sides. Built in the 19th century, it represents the enlightened spirit of the time and remains a lively spot for locals and visitors alike.

Casco Viejo
Bilbao’s Old Town, or Zazpikaleak, is a charming maze of seven streets full of history. Each street, named after the old trades that once defined the area, offers a unique glimpse into the city’s past, from Somera to Barrenkale.

San Anton eliza
Built in the mid-15th century, the Church of San Antón combines Gothic elements with various architectural styles. It is the oldest church in Bilbao, with archaeological finds showing it predates the city's founding in 1300.

Mercado de La Ribera
Located by the Bilbao estuary, Mercado de la Ribera is a spacious and light-filled market known for its eclectic design. With no internal columns and large Art Deco features, it creates a bright, welcoming atmosphere for visitors to explore its diverse offerings.
